首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Python Openpyxl调度将时间戳范围替换为字符串

Python Openpyxl是一个用于操作Excel文件的库。它可以读取、写入和修改Excel文件中的数据。在处理Excel文件时,有时需要将时间戳范围替换为字符串。下面是一个完善且全面的答案:

在Python中,可以使用Openpyxl库来实现将时间戳范围替换为字符串的调度。首先,需要安装Openpyxl库,可以使用pip命令进行安装:

代码语言:txt
复制
pip install openpyxl

接下来,可以使用以下代码来实现将时间戳范围替换为字符串的调度:

代码语言:txt
复制
import openpyxl
from datetime import datetime

# 打开Excel文件
workbook = openpyxl.load_workbook('example.xlsx')

# 选择要操作的工作表
sheet = workbook['Sheet1']

# 遍历每个单元格
for row in sheet.iter_rows(min_row=2, max_row=sheet.max_row, min_col=1, max_col=sheet.max_column):
    for cell in row:
        # 判断单元格的值是否为时间戳范围
        if isinstance(cell.value, datetime):
            # 将时间戳范围转换为字符串
            cell.value = cell.value.strftime('%Y-%m-%d %H:%M:%S')

# 保存修改后的Excel文件
workbook.save('example_modified.xlsx')

上述代码中,首先使用openpyxl.load_workbook函数打开Excel文件,然后选择要操作的工作表。接着,使用iter_rows方法遍历每个单元格,判断单元格的值是否为时间戳范围。如果是时间戳范围,则使用strftime方法将其转换为字符串,并将转换后的值赋给单元格。最后,使用save方法保存修改后的Excel文件。

这是一个简单的示例,可以根据实际需求进行修改和扩展。如果想了解更多关于Openpyxl库的信息,可以访问腾讯云的产品介绍页面:Openpyxl产品介绍

请注意,以上答案仅供参考,具体实现方式可能因实际情况而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python办公自动化|从Excel到Word

点击上方『早起Python』关注并星标公众号 第一时间接收最新Python干货! ?...前言 在前几天的文章中我们讲解了如何从Word表格中提取指定数据并按照格式保存到Excel中,今天我们再次以一位读者提出的真实需求来讲解如何使用Python从Excel中计算、整理数据并写入Word...Python实现 首先我们使用Python对该Excel进行解析 from openpyxl import load_workbook import os # 获取桌面的路径 def GetDesktopPath...,如果要批处理循环迭代也方便 # 获取有数据范围 print(sheet.dimensions) # A1:W10 利用openpyxl读取单元格有以下几种用法 cells = sheet['A1:A4...猛可查看) ? Python两招轻松爬取美团评论 ? NumPy进阶修炼|基础 ? NumPy进阶修炼|入门 ? 用Python唱一首程序员版“惊雷” ?

3.4K40

python常用模块大全_python常用第三方模块大全

而其他语言如Java单位是”毫秒”,当跨平台计算时间需要注意这个差别 实战例子 # 需求:python生成的时间换为java的格式来匹配你们公司的java后端 timestamp = str(..., 3)python默认是保留6位小数,这里保留3位小数,因为python时间单位是秒,java是毫秒, 3.第2步得到的结果int(),确保是int类型,再乘以1000,时间单位转换为毫秒 4...时间对应的本地日期 time类 datetime.time(hour=0, minute=0, second=0, microsecond=0, tzinfo=None) 日期时间格式化 str转换为...datetime 很多时候,用户输入的日期和时间字符串,要处理日期和时间,首先必须把str转换为datetime。...,就需要转换为str,转换方法是通过strftime()实现的,同样需要一个日期和时间的格式化字符串: from datetime import datetime now = datetime.now(

3.8K30

python常用模块大全_python常用

而其他语言如Java单位是”毫秒”,当跨平台计算时间需要注意这个差别 实战例子 # 需求:python生成的时间换为java的格式来匹配你们公司的java后端 timestamp = str(..., 3)python默认是保留6位小数,这里保留3位小数,因为python时间单位是秒,java是毫秒, 3.第2步得到的结果int(),确保是int类型,再乘以1000,时间单位转换为毫秒 4...时间对应的本地日期 time类 datetime.time(hour=0, minute=0, second=0, microsecond=0, tzinfo=None) 日期时间格式化 str转换为...datetime 很多时候,用户输入的日期和时间字符串,要处理日期和时间,首先必须把str转换为datetime。...,就需要转换为str,转换方法是通过strftime()实现的,同样需要一个日期和时间的格式化字符串: from datetime import datetime now = datetime.now(

3.4K20

Python 时间处理全解析:从基础到实战

time、datetime 和 calendar 是Python中处理时间的重要模块。time 提供基本的时间功能,如获取时间和睡眠。...,并指定时区为UTCcurrent_time_utc = datetime.now(utc_timezone)print("当前时间 (UTC):", current_time_utc)# 时间换为指定时区...时区处理对于全球化的应用或需要跟踪不同地区时间的场景非常重要。7. 时间格式化与解析datetime 模块还提供了强大的时间格式化与解析功能,可以时间对象转换为字符串,也可以字符串换为时间对象。...from datetime import datetime# 时间对象转换为字符串now = datetime.now()formatted_time = now.strftime("%Y-%m-%d...%H:%M:%S")print("格式化后的时间:", formatted_time)# 字符串换为时间对象str_time = "2024-02-29 12:30:00"parsed_time =

32320

python转化excel数字日期为标准日期操作

伙伴遇到一个关于excel导入数据到python中,日期变成数字而不是日期格式的问题。第一反应这个数字应该是excel里面的时间类似的,所以我就实验增加一天是不是对应的数字就加1。...我们再看看python直接导入后日期的样子: ? 那我们的目标就是字段列名的日期数据替换成标准的日期格式,具体的思路是: 1、先用excel实验2018-11-02对应的日期时间是43406。...以下代码是excel时间转化成标准日期,并替换原有列名的具体步骤: import pandas as pd import datetime data=pd.read_excel(r'xxxx.xlsx...(days=dates) today=datetime.datetime.strptime('1899-12-30','%Y-%m-%d')+delta#1899-12-30转化为可以计算的时间格式并加上要转化的日期...:python做Excel表(显示时间) 如下所示: ?

3.6K20

如何使用Python进行数据清洗?

Python提供了丰富的库和工具,使数据清洗变得更加高效和便捷。本文详细介绍数据清洗的概念、常见的数据质量问题以及如何使用Python进行数据清洗。图片1....处理异常值:发现并处理数据中的异常值,如错误的测量、超过合理范围的数值等。处理重复数据:去除数据集中的重复记录,以避免对分析结果产生误导。...转换数据格式:数据转换为合适的格式,如日期时间格式的转换、数值的转换等。处理数据的结构问题:对于数据集的结构问题,可以进行重新排序、合并、拆分等操作。2....2.5 数据格式问题数据格式问题包括日期时间格式、数值格式等。不同数据源可能使用不同的格式,需要将其转换为统一的格式以便进行后续分析。...Regular Expressions:正则表达式是用于匹配、查找和替换字符串的强大工具。它可以用来处理不一致数据和数据格式问题。OpenpyxlOpenpyxl是一个用于读写Excel文件的库。

38830

opencv+python制作硬核七夕礼物

重磅干货,第一时间送达 ? 来源:OpenCV视觉实践 ? 明天就是七夕了! 如果有对象,祝早生贵子!没有对象,祝早结连理!...(搞笑一下,祝大家幸福美满吧,嘿嘿嘿) 给大家准备了一份已经写好的代码,利用python+opencv+openpyxl,opencv实现读取图片像素颜色,然后openpyxl自动填充Excel表格对应单元格背景颜色...配置环境 我们需要用到python以及openpyxl和opencv包,没有下载的小伙伴可以去配置一下,超级简单: 大概就是在python终端(看个人环境)执行: pip install opencv-python...height = srcImage.shape[0] width = srcImage.shape[1] print("height:", height, "width:", width) 利用opencv图像读取进来...所以我们需要自己写一个函数RGB颜色格式转换为十六进制: #自定义函数,RGB颜色值转换为16进制的字符串格式 def color_transform(value): digit = list

92710

Python编程快速上手——Excel表格创建乘法表案例分析

脚本,生成新的excel文件 excel文件包含n*n的乘法矩阵 – 代码需要做一下事情: 导入openpyxl,sys模块 openpyxl.Workbook()创建新的工作薄对象 get_sheet_by_name...python3 import openpyxl,sys from openpyxl.styles import Font #输入Font代替输入openpyxl.styles.Font() newExcel...= openpyxl.Workbook() #新建工作簿对象 sheet = newExcel.get_sheet_by_name("Sheet") n = int(sys.argv[1]) #sys.argv...接收到的参数转换为int型 fontObj = Font(bold = True) #设置字体加粗 for i in range(1,n+1): sheet.cell(row=i+1,column...》、《Python函数使用技巧总结》、《Python字符串操作技巧汇总》及《Python入门与进阶经典教程》 希望本文所述对大家Python程序设计有所帮助。

77330

最全总结 | 聊聊 Python 办公自动化之 Excel(中)

聊聊 Python 数据处理全家桶(Memca 篇) 点击上方“AirPython”,选择“加为星标” 第一时间关注 Python 技术干货! ? 1....前言 上一篇文章中,我们聊到使用 xlrd、xlwt、xlutils 这一组合操作 Excel 的方法 最全总结 | 聊聊 Python 办公自动化之 Excel(上) 本篇文章继续聊另外一种方式,...和 Python 列表范围取值类似,openpyxl 同样支持使用 : 符号拿到某个范围内的数据行[列] def get_rows_by_range(sheet, row_index_start, row_index_end...): """ 通过范围去选择行范围 比如:选择第2行到第4行的所有数据,返回值为元组 :param sheet: :param row_index_start:...提供的 add_image() 方法 参数有 2 个,分别是:图片对象、单元格字符串索引 为了便于使用,我们可以列索引进行转换,然后封装成两个插入图片的方法 from openpyxl.drawing.image

1.5K30

opencv+python制作硬核七夕礼物

(搞笑一下,祝大家幸福美满吧,嘿嘿嘿) 给大家准备了一份已经写好的代码,利用python+opencv+openpyxl,opencv实现读取图片像素颜色,然后openpyxl自动填充Excel表格对应单元格背景颜色...配置环境 我们需要用到python以及openpyxl和opencv包,没有下载的小伙伴可以去配置一下,超级简单: 大概就是在python终端(看个人环境)执行: pip install opencv-python...srcImage 如果按原始大小读取图片,可以改为:srcImage = cv.imread('zhu.jpg') 加上第二个参数33:srcImage = cv.imread('zhu.jpg',33) 表示原图缩为原来的...height = srcImage.shape[0] width = srcImage.shape[1] print("height:", height, "width:", width) 利用opencv图像读取进来...所以我们需要自己写一个函数RGB颜色格式转换为十六进制: #自定义函数,RGB颜色值转换为16进制的字符串格式 def color_transform(value): digit = list

97420

2小时完成的第一个副业单子:Python修正excel表格数据

一、前言 大家好,今天我来介绍一下我接的zhenguo老师的第一个Python单子。我完成这个单子前后不到2小时。...我是运用面向过程写的,每一步都放在了不同的函数中,下面让我来介绍一下我是怎么通过自己的思路一步一步完成的。...除了运用到openpyxl和random还用到了openpyxl中的utils包下cell模块的两个方法,第一个方法get_column_letter的作用是整型转换为对应excel中列属性的字符串...,例如:12转换为L,50转换为AX 第二个方法是字符串换为整型,其本质类似于10进制和27进制之间的转换,当然你也可以自己写,下面附上自己写的行(整型)转换为列(字符串)的代码。...'日期':             for i in range(ord('B'),ord('I')):                 material = []                 #日期转换为与生产记录更新中相对应写法的形式

1.2K30

基于word文档,使用Python输出关键词和词频,并将关键词的词性也标注出来

一、前言 前几天在有个粉丝问了个问题,大概意思是这样的:基于Python代码,要求输出word文档中的关键词和词频,并且关键词的词性也标注出来,最终输出一个Excel文件,一共3列,列名分别是关键词、...content = doc.Content.Text # 字符串转为列表,并进行分词和词性标注 words = jieba.cut(content) tags = [word.tag for word...sheet.write(i+1, 0, word) sheet.write(i+1, 1, str(freq)) sheet.write(i+1, 2, tags[i]) # 分词结果转换为列表并写入...并将其存入一个字符串中。...使用 openpyxl 库创建一个 Excel 文件,并在其中创建一个工作表。 关键词、词性和词频分别写入文件的不同列中。

21620

opencv+python制作硬核七夕礼物

(搞笑一下,祝大家幸福美满吧,嘿嘿嘿) 给大家准备了一份已经写好的代码,利用python+opencv+openpyxl,opencv实现读取图片像素颜色,然后openpyxl自动填充Excel表格对应单元格背景颜色...配置环境 我们需要用到python以及openpyxl和opencv包,没有下载的小伙伴可以去配置一下,超级简单: 大概就是在python终端(看个人环境)执行: pip install opencv-pythonpip...install openpyxl 下面是我安装openpyxl包的录屏,可以参考一下,也可以跳过。...height = srcImage.shape[0]width = srcImage.shape[1]print("height:", height, "width:", width) 利用opencv图像读取进来...所以我们需要自己写一个函数RGB颜色格式转换为十六进制: #自定义函数,RGB颜色值转换为16进制的字符串格式def color_transform(value): digit = list(

65420

分析 Pandas 源码,解决读取 Excel 报错问题

使用 Pandas 的 read_excel 方法读取一个 16 万行的 Excel 文件报 AssertionError 错误: "/Users/XXX/excel_test/venv/lib/python3.7...需要注意的是, .xlsx 格式的文件转换为 .xls 格式的文件时,65,536 行和 256 列之后的数据都会被丢弃。...Pandas 读取 Excel 文件的引擎是 xlrd,xlrd 在读取 Excel 文件时,xlrd/xlsx.py(https://github.com/python-excel/xlrd/blob.../master/xlrd/xlsx.py) 文件的 637 行会对行号做断言,判断行号是否在 0 - 1,048,576(Excel支持的最大行数) 的范围内。...(0.25 版),openpyxl 是一个专门用来操作 .xlsx 格式文件的 Python 库,和 xlrd 相比它的速度会慢一些,但是不会碰到上面所说的问题。

2.1K20

Python for Excel》读书笔记连载17:使用读写器包进行Excel文件操作(上)

2022年的第3天,Python for Excel》的这篇连载免费送给你,一起学起来。...Excel文件的一些Python软件包,包括OpenPyXL、XlsxWriter、pyxlsb、xlrd和xlwt和xlutils,以及如何处理大型Excel文件、如何pandas与reader和writer...有兴趣的朋友,可以到知识星球完美Excel社群第一时间获取《Python for Excel》完整内容及其它丰富的资源。...下面的代码生成如图8-1所示的文件: 如果要写入Excel模板文件,则需要在保存之前template属性设置为True: 正如在代码中看到的,OpenPyXL通过提供类似FF0000的字符串来设置颜色...但它目前也无法通过Conda获得,因此使用pip进行安装: pip install pyxlsb 读取工作表和单元格值如下: pyxlsb目前无法识别带有日期的单元格,因此必须手动日期格式单元格中的值转换为

3.8K20
领券